> The Scripting Bundle Maven Plugin currently imposes the following restriction
> for the project structure:
> {noformat}
> <scriptsDirectory>/<sling-resourceType>/<version>/[<METHOD>.]<name>[.<selector>][.<requestExtension>].<script-extension>
> {noformat}
> In this case the {{<sling-resourceType>}} will be limited to one folder,
> which means that resource type namespacing should be done similar to Java
> package names. While this is not wrong, the plugin should also allow defining
> the resource types using Sling's already established conventions [0], e.g.
> resource tree paths relative to a search path. In addition, the {{<version>}}
> folder should become optional.
